My Project
mlir::gpu::GPUDialect Member List

This is the complete list of members for mlir::gpu::GPUDialect, including all inherited members.

addAttributes()mlir::Dialectinlineprotected
addInterface(std::unique_ptr< DialectInterface > interface)mlir::Dialectprotected
addInterfaces()mlir::Dialectinlineprotected
addInterfaces()mlir::Dialectinlineprotected
addOperation(AbstractOperation opInfo)mlir::Dialectprotected
addOperations()mlir::Dialectinlineprotected
addTypes()mlir::Dialectinlineprotected
allowsUnknownOperations() constmlir::Dialectinline
allowsUnknownTypes() constmlir::Dialectinline
allowUnknownOperations(bool allow=true)mlir::Dialectinlineprotected
allowUnknownTypes(bool allow=true)mlir::Dialectinlineprotected
constantFoldHookmlir::Dialect
decodeHookmlir::Dialect
Dialect(StringRef name, MLIRContext *context)mlir::Dialectprotected
extractElementHookmlir::Dialect
getContainerModuleAttrName()mlir::gpu::GPUDialectinlinestatic
getContext() constmlir::Dialectinline
getDialectName()mlir::gpu::GPUDialectstatic
getDialectNamespace()mlir::gpu::GPUDialectinlinestatic
getKernelFuncAttrName()mlir::gpu::GPUDialectinlinestatic
getKernelModuleAttrName()mlir::gpu::GPUDialectinlinestatic
getNamespace() constmlir::Dialectinline
getNumWorkgroupDimensions()mlir::gpu::GPUDialectinlinestatic
getPrivateAddressSpace()mlir::gpu::GPUDialectinlinestatic
getRegisteredInterface(ClassID *interfaceID)mlir::Dialectinline
getRegisteredInterface()mlir::Dialectinline
getWorkgroupAddressSpace()mlir::gpu::GPUDialectinlinestatic
GPUDialect(MLIRContext *context)mlir::gpu::GPUDialectexplicit
isKernel(Operation *op)mlir::gpu::GPUDialectstatic
isValidNamespace(StringRef str)mlir::Dialectstatic
materializeConstant(OpBuilder &builder, Attribute value, Type type, Location loc)mlir::Dialectinlinevirtual
parseAttribute(DialectAsmParser &parser, Type type) constmlir::Dialectvirtual
parseType(DialectAsmParser &parser) constmlir::Dialectvirtual
printAttribute(Attribute, DialectAsmPrinter &) constmlir::Dialectinlinevirtual
printType(Type, DialectAsmPrinter &) constmlir::Dialectinlinevirtual
verifyOperationAttribute(Operation *op, NamedAttribute attr) overridemlir::gpu::GPUDialectvirtual
verifyRegionArgAttribute(Operation *, unsigned regionIndex, unsigned argIndex, NamedAttribute)mlir::Dialectvirtual
verifyRegionResultAttribute(Operation *, unsigned regionIndex, unsigned resultIndex, NamedAttribute)mlir::Dialectvirtual
~Dialect()mlir::Dialectvirtual